一種外積累加求解稀疏矩陣與稠密矩陣內(nèi)積的方法

基本信息

申請(qǐng)?zhí)?/td> CN202110104426.1 申請(qǐng)日 -
公開(公告)號(hào) CN112835552A 公開(公告)日 2021-05-25
申請(qǐng)公布號(hào) CN112835552A 申請(qǐng)公布日 2021-05-25
分類號(hào) G06F7/544;G06F17/16 分類 計(jì)算;推算;計(jì)數(shù);
發(fā)明人 周曉輝;袁博;華誠 申請(qǐng)(專利權(quán))人 算籌信息科技有限公司
代理機(jī)構(gòu) 濟(jì)南譽(yù)琨知識(shí)產(chǎn)權(quán)代理事務(wù)所(普通合伙) 代理人 李照蘭
地址 518000 廣東省深圳市福田區(qū)福田街道福安社區(qū)益田路5033號(hào)平安金融中心71層
法律狀態(tài) -

摘要

摘要 本發(fā)明屬于計(jì)算機(jī)應(yīng)用技術(shù)領(lǐng)域,尤其涉及一種外積累加求解稀疏矩陣與稠密矩陣內(nèi)積的方法。包括以下有效步驟:首先對(duì)稀疏矩陣A(MxK)與稠密矩陣B(KxN)原始數(shù)據(jù)的完成讀?。粚?duì)稀疏矩陣A(MxK)進(jìn)行列向數(shù)據(jù)壓縮,將二維布局的稀疏矩陣A(MxK)列向壓縮為一維布局的列向壓縮稀疏矩陣A(MxK);讀取列向壓縮稀疏矩陣A(MxK)第i列以及讀取稠密矩陣B(KxN)第i行外積運(yùn)算生成ci;對(duì)所得到的外積結(jié)果進(jìn)行累加,即可得到稀疏矩陣A(MxK)與稠密矩陣B(KxN)的內(nèi)積。本發(fā)明通過將原有的二維布局的稀疏矩陣A(MxK)列向壓縮為一維布局的列向壓縮稀疏矩陣A(MxK),除去了稀疏矩陣A(MxK)的零元素值,進(jìn)而避免了無效數(shù)值的計(jì)算,達(dá)到節(jié)省內(nèi)存訪問和無效運(yùn)算的目的,從而提高了運(yùn)算效率。